Linguoverted mandibular canine teeth (LMC) is a common malocclusion in dogs. Several inclined bite-plane techniques using acrylic resin have been introduced to correct LMC in dogs. Although these techniques have suggested modifications to overcome shortcomings, there are still limitations; ., high technical sensitivity, as the viscous acrylic resin must still be fabricated in the oral cavity. The authors developed a novel method for small-breed dogs that uses a doughy acrylic resin form to achieve an easy intraoral design and extraoral fabrication. Eight small-breed dogs were presented to evaluate and treat malocclusion causing palatal trauma. First, a Class-1 malocclusion with linguoversion of the mandibular canine teeth (6 dogs with unilateral LMC and 2 dogs with bilateral) was diagnosed based on oral examination. Dogs were treated with the new method using a doughy acrylic resin form for 6 to 7 wk and had posttreatment follow-up 1 y after the procedure. All treated canine teeth were in correct positions 1 y after the appliances were removed. Key clinical message: The authors believe that the new method using a doughy acrylic resin form could be a good alternative for veterinarians to use when treating LMC.
